Transaction 71ff53e21dc252bd02a91aad23f499551103c0237b1641851a78856ab3a9f74c
2 Input
2 Outputs
- 71ff53e21dc252bd02a91aad23f499551103c0237b1641851a78856ab3a9f74c:0
- 71ff53e21dc252bd02a91aad23f499551103c0237b1641851a78856ab3a9f74c:1
value 10043747
address 1EUHJgp9SXaDX3ZwrpJPv1NY2Jcpyi8QTR
value 50822
address 18n3uMzM2Qwn4ZGDaHCUHLTyc2WQUudDJA